I was immediately drawn to the gorgeous colors in the inspiration piece, and I knew I had the perfect nautical collection tucked away in the stack of papers I am working to use up this year. The soft blues, sandy neutrals, and gentle florals in the collection felt like a lovely match for the theme.

For the main panel, I die cut several scraps from the collection and selected two special pieces to feature. One showcases a delicate sea shell, and the other highlights a beautiful flower that brings a touch of elegance to the design. Each die cut circle is layered on a grey die cut for contrast, and the top two circles are popped up on dimensionals to create a little lift and interest.

To complete the card, I added another piece from the collection as the background layer, mounted on grey cardstock and then placed on a crisp white card base. The Heartfelt Thanks sentiment is popped up on dimensionals so it stands out nicely, and a few candy dots finish the card with a simple, cheerful touch.

This card came together with a mix of color inspiration, favorite papers, and a little dimension, and I love how peaceful and pretty it feels.

Oh how I would love another boat ride to be on the water enjoying the breeze.

Masked off the card added some blue and yellow. Added white gel pen for waves. Sponged on some clouds. Stamped the image and the sentiment. I like to add the stitching die cut to the edge to add some extra texture and focal to a card. It can be used for masculine and feminine cards.
